Output 56d574de1576eda98c63fd8dd5cca8dcc839b1c8d53b225eac817795e7934b00:21

value
152657313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 280302990e3b6f05e649d77f05575c6dd0535c9c OP_EQUAL
address
MBYisFaVFG8zEH1JQjpwLbL4ahyWVRgqav
transaction
56d574de1576eda98c63fd8dd5cca8dcc839b1c8d53b225eac817795e7934b00
spent
true